Jose Mourinho eyeing deal for Chelsea midfielder

AS Roma manager Jose Mourinho is reportedly interested in landing Chelsea midfielder Ruben Loftus-Cheek.
The Giallorossi recently signed Blues striker Tammy Abraham under the recommendation of the Portuguese.
Abraham made a huge impression on debut with a brace, and he could now be reunited with compatriot Loftus-Cheek.
The 25-year-old is out-of-favour with the Blues at the moment, and he has been fancied to leave on loan this month.
Roma have been interested in Denis Zakaria from Borussia Monchengladbach, but a deal seems highly unlikely.
They are willing to pay around €10-15m, but the German outfit won't accept anything less than €20m for his services.
Hence, Loftus-Cheek has now emerged on the radar. A deal could be straightforward with Mourinho's close links with Chelsea.
The former Blues boss continues to share a good bond with the hierarchy.
Meanwhile, Mourinho handed Loftus-Cheek his Blues debut in 2014. The midfielder could be tempted by the prospect of a reunion.
